Gorringe Antiques has a large collection of frequently changing Renй Lalique vases. Renй Lalique is one of the world's greatest glass makers and jewellery designers of the art Nouveau and art Deco periods. In 1882 he became a freelance designer for several top jewellery houses in Paris and four years later established his own jewellery workshop. less

Anthony Bush, our Managing Director, started the company more than 35 years ago. He began his career at an early age from his family home in Kingsbury, north London. When he left school he joined a firm of solicitors and during his lunchbreaks he spent time hunting for antiques in central London. After four years he decided to go it alone and with £200 and a £60 van he created Bushwood Antiques. less

Situated near to Glasgow University the area was once the home of Charles Rennie Mackintosh and his circle and the influential 'Celtic Revival', A rts and Crafts metalworker, Margaret Gilmour. In fact her workshop was literally around the corner from Authentics. Nowadays the area is a haven for cafes and artisan, independent and quirky shops. less
